Bejeweled Twist存档修改器V0.1 帮助文档

软件作者: 不想再用旧号了

软件版本: V0.1

日期:  2010.8.10

联系邮箱: nomorepast#126.com

一.前言

这是本人第一次做的软件啊,先感动下>_<~~~

因为本人学过dos下的c语言,对华丽的Windows界面毫无办法,于是回避了界面问题采取txt编辑后软件转码修改的方法,修改方法掌握以后不算难,而且易于保存备份和交流~

二.编辑txt文档

使用存档修改器你先需要编写指定格式的txt文档,它包含有一系列如下示例的模块:

start

color

红红红红红红红红

黄黄黄黄黄黄黄黄

绿绿绿绿绿绿绿绿

蓝蓝蓝蓝蓝蓝蓝蓝

橙橙橙橙橙橙橙橙

紫紫紫紫紫紫紫紫

白白白白白白白白

红黄绿蓝橙紫白红

end

start

fruit

水水水水水水水水

XXXXXXXX

XXXXXXXX

XXXXXXXX

XXXXXXXX

XXXXXXXX

XXXXXXXX

XXXXXXXX

end

start

bomb

XXXXXXXX

XXXXXXXX

XXXXXXXX

XXXXXXXX

XXXXXXXX

XXXXXXXX

0102122355889900

XXXXXXXX

end

其中start和end是固定格式,分别是模块开始和结束的标志.

color,fruit,bomb等是可选选项,描述内容的属性.

txt就是通过多个这样的模板来描述游戏各个位置的宝石的属性,从而确定你想修改成样子的.

三.描述的方法

描述的种类有3种,一个是颜色,一个是属性,一个是倒数.

颜色:用于color选项,用来表示宝石的颜色,这个txt文档中必不可少的部分.

属性:用于fruit,fire,lightening,supernova,coal和lock选项,用来表示宝石的附加属性,如是否水果,是否火焰等.

倒数:用于doom和bomb选项,用来设置死亡倒计时.

描述的方法是,用全角的汉字(字符)或一次2个半角字符填充成一个8*8的方阵,用来表示游戏对应位置宝石的状态.根据描述的种类和可选选项不同,描述有不同的要求.

颜色:有效的汉字是"红,黄,绿,蓝,橙,紫,白",其它汉字或未填会自动默认为红色.

属性:根据不同的选项有效汉字不同,只有有效汉字会给对应宝石添加该属性.详细看下表.

倒数:如果要给某个宝石添加倒数描述,则要在对应位置用2位数字表示倒计时的数字.注意前面必须是全角汉字或者双数半角字符,否则2位数字将被分开两半.相邻格子的数字必需紧贴,不能有空格.

以下是所有可选选项和有效描述字符:

color 宝石的颜色 红,黄,绿,蓝,橙,紫,白

fruit 水果宝石 水

fire 火焰宝石 火

lightening 闪电宝石 闪

supernova 超新星宝石 超

coal 煤矿 矿

doom 毁灭宝石 00-99以内的数字

bomb 炸弹 00-99以内的数字

lock 锁 锁

四.存档修改

本修改器适合于8*8方阵的classic和zen存档,游戏存档位于...Bejeweled Twisusers你的用户名 

classic和zen的存档的文件名分别是savegame_classic.dat和savegame_zen.dat

要进行修改,首先把要修改的存档,修改器和txt文档放在同一个目录下面,把存档名字改为save.dat,把txt文档名字改为s.txt,然后运行修改器.等出现的黑框一闪而过后,再把save.dat改回成savegame_classic.dat或savegame_zen.dat就大功告成,可以进入游戏看看效果了~

要注意本修改器没有自动备份功能,所以大家有需要记得要手动备份哦~

五.其它

压缩包中附带了两个txt文档例子(sample.txt,sample2.txt)和一个文档模板(template.txt),大家可以照葫芦画瓢在做做看.sample.txt是所有宝石的一个事例,而sample2.txt则是一个有趣的高cascades,是我实际运用测试的第一个txt文档.

该修改器规避附加属性的重叠,大家想考验一下自己的游戏的可以随便乱搞一下^_^

...另外由于是初始版本,虽然自己测试通过了,但不知道会出现什么bug,有bug或者其它问题或建议的话请务必邮件联系,我的邮箱是nomorepast@126.com

也可以直接来百度贴吧宝石迷阵吧提问,身为作者我一定会耐心回答的~

宝石迷阵吧:http://tieba.baidu.com/f?kw=%B1%A6%CA%AF%C3%D4%D5%F3

谢谢大家~~